Director, Regulatory Affairs

Veristat
Posted 3 hours ago
🇺🇸United States🏠Remote💰$195.0K–$223.0K📁Legal & Compliance
Is this job info correct?

Job Description: Director, Regulatory Affairs Director Regulatory Affairs, responsible for strategic and operational regulatory consulting for client companies. The Director RA will be client facing and will be responsible amongst others for: Strategic Advice to clients, with focus on early development through to NDA/ BLA Independent preparation of regulatory documentation such as US IND, NDA/BLA modules, ODD, Fast track / other designations, FDA advice requests. Scientific Interaction with internal cross functional teams Client facing & Agency point of contact: Interaction with clients and FDA, lead interactions with Health Authorities Internal BD & marketing facing role Make an Impact at Veristat! Join a global team with more than 30 years of expertise accelerating life-changing therapies to patients worldwide. 105+ approved therapies for marketing applications prepared by Veristat 480+ oncology projects in the past 5 years 350+ rare disease projects delivered in the past 5 years Flexible, inclusive culture — 70% remote workforce, 66% women-led teams Learn more about our core values here ! What we offer - The estimated hiring range for this role is $195K-223K plus applicable bonus. This hiring range is specific to the US and will vary for other regions based upon local market data. Final salary is ultimately decided upon taking into account a wide range of factors, including but not limited to: skills and experience, licensure and certifications, education, specific location and dynamic market data. - Benefits vary by location and may include: Remote working Flexible time off Paid holidays Medical insurance Tuition reimbursement Retirement plans What we look for Bachelor’s degree in science, toxicology, pharmacology, engineering or related field; Advanced Scientific degree such as Master’s degree, Ph.D. or Pharm.D. preferred, with applied training relevant to clinical trials. 10 years of relevant experience working directly for a CRO/ Pharmaceutical Company, with a minimum 5 years of experience leading regulatory development projects. Thorough knowledge of International Conference on Harmonisation (ICH) Good Clinical Practice (GCP) guidelines and other applicable regulatory rules and guidelines as well as of medical terminology, clinical trials, and clinical research. Excellent written and oral communication skills including grammatical and technical writing skills, and familiarity with moderately complex study designs and regulatory requirements that apply to Phase I-IV clinical trials are required. In-depth knowledge of the relationship and regulatory obligation of the contract research organization (CRO) industry with pharmaceutical / biotech companies. Demonstrated ability to lead by example with demonstrated skill for technical and supervisory leadership of staff. Skilled in use of computer software, including Microsoft Word and Microsoft Excel, and ability to learn new applications. Excellent interpersonal, communication, and organizational skills with the ability to work independently and in a team environment. Veristat is an equal opportunity employer.
